Handover Note — Supplier Renewal

For the finance team: the Bryncott Materials contract expires end of Q3. Terms are acceptable; volume rebate needs renegotiation. I've flagged a 4% cost increase in their draft. Orla Vestin takes over negotiations from here. Budget impact is modest. Context on our position follows immediately below.

board note of bawep-tajef: Queniusek Systems plans to raise the Quenvan list price by 53.1 percent in March. The pricing group signed off on a budget of $176.4 million for Project Drueth. The renewal with Casionix Partners closes at $142.5 million a year, 8.3 percent below the last contract. Project Fraax slips by six weeks because of the tooling delay.

## Doclint runbook

Reviewers: the Plumeline doc linter runs on every merge request touching docs/. Warnings block merge; suppressions need a justification comment. If the linter hangs, kill the job and rerun — it's a known cache race. Don't edit rules inline; change them centrally. The linter service runs with the following configuration.

deployment values, fahap-hahaf:
[casdor]
port = 9200
region = south-2
host = casdor.qirvanworks.corp
timeout_ms = 3000
retries = 4

Hello plugin authors,

Next Thursday, Corbexa will run a disaster-recovery drill for the RestockRoute vending-machine restock planner. During the failover window, plugin callbacks will be replayed against the standby scheduler, so please ensure your handlers are idempotent and tolerate duplicate route assignments. No customer restock data will be altered. To re-register your plugin against the standby environment during the drill, authenticate with the recovery passphrase provided below.

vault phrase of hahip-tajeg = quenax-briath-briax

Vendoring fonts for the Ashgrove design system: all third-party typefaces live in `vendor/fonts`, checked in with their license files. Never pull fonts at build time; the Ashgrove build farm has no outbound network. To add a font, drop the files in, update the manifest with license type and version, and run `fontcheck` to validate metadata and subsetting. CI rejects unlisted files. After a clean `fontcheck` pass, record the resulting verification token below.

pipeline stamp: htk9_ce63042d9